Music Review // PICKLE JUICE "Halfway"
There is a certain genre of music which often gets overlooked and it's how the gritty rock n roll sound can combine with punk rock to form something like Pickle Juice. Elements of Buckcherry and The Living End come out in this song, but it's ultimately this idea where it's fast paced and catchy enough to be punk rock but with a little bit more complexity to it, as the music itself comes from a great deal of talent.
The way that this song goes lyrically has the line in the chorus which says: "I'm sick of being halfway you and halfway me". It's about finding your identity, finding out who you truly are, and that can be for any number of reasons. In this music video, there is a character on the couch and also watching television. This plays into that idea of living your life through the people you see on tv and not having it be your own. You need to find out who you are.
But there are plenty of reasons why someone could feel like they're living two lives and one is not true to who they really are. You could be pretending to be someone else around others for various reasons or just, as this song seems to be about, not living up to your full potential. Maybe you do things creatively but you should be focusing on those more than just wasting your time. Perhaps in addition to finding yourself, this song is about not squandering your gift.
Before the end of this song there is a rather long and complicated guitar solo, which does remind me of Bad Religion. I just feel like there was a time in the late 1990's going into the early 2000's where labels like Epitaph were just putting out different types of punk music, like New Bomb Turks, and this would've just fit so well within those early Punk-O-Rama days.
